Hidden functionality issue exists in multiple MFPs provided by Brother Industries, Ltd., which may allow an attacker to obtain the logs of the affected product and obtain sensitive information within the logs.
Multiple MFPs provided by Brother Industries, Ltd. does not properly validate server certificates, which may allow a man-in-the-middle attacker to replace the set of root certificates used by the product with a set of arbitrary certificates.
Brother BRAdmin Professional 3.75 contains an unquoted service path vulnerability in the BRA_Scheduler service that allows local users to potentially execute arbitrary code. Attackers can place a malicious executable named 'BRAdmin' in the C:\Program Files (x86)\Brother\ directory to gain local system privileges.
Brother BRPrint Auditor 3.0.7 contains an unquoted service path vulnerability in its Windows service configurations that allows local attackers to potentially execute arbitrary code. Attackers can exploit the unquoted file paths in BrAuSvc and BRPA_Agent services to inject malicious executables and escalate privileges on the system.
